| ln Vitro |
Cyclic-di-GMP sodium(0.5-50 µM; 5 days) prevents the growth of colon cancer cells in humans[1]. In Jurkat cells, cyclic-di-GMP sodium (0.5-50 µM; 5 days) selectively increases CD4 expression[2]. In Jurkat cells, cyclic-di-GMP sodium (0.5-50 µM; 5 days) causes cell cycle arrest at the S-phase[2].
|
| ln Vivo |
The administration of two consecutive vaccinations spaced nine days apart with cyclic-di-GMP sodium (100 µg/per) improves the immune responses TriVax elicits in mice against melanoma and amplifies its anti-tumor effects[3].

| Cell Assay |
Cell Proliferation Assay[1]
Cell Types: H508 cells Tested Concentrations: 0.5-50 µM Incubation Duration: 5 days Experimental Results: decreased basal H508 cell proliferation by approx 15%, even inhibited acetylcholine- and EGF-induced cell proliferation. Cell Viability Assay[2] Cell Types: Jurkat cells Tested Concentrations: 50 µM Incubation Duration: 24 h Experimental Results: Specifically induced of CD4(no effect on the expression of CD8), with a 6.3-fold upregulation over control and in a dose-dependent manner. Cell Cycle Analysis[2] Cell Types: Jurkat cells Tested Concentrations: 50 µM Incubation Duration: 24 h Experimental Results: Increased the percentage of cells in S-phase by 79%, with almost complete disappearance of G2/M-phase cells which diminished by 93%. |
| Animal Protocol |
Animal/Disease Models: C57BL/ 6 (B6) mice (8- to 10weeks old)[3].
Doses: 100 µg/per Route of Administration: intravenous (iv) injection; two sequential vaccinations 9 days apart; combine with TriVax. Experimental Results: Dramatically higher numbers of antigen-specific CD8 T cells when combined with TriVax. (TriVax consisted of a mixture of 120 μg Pam-hgp100, 100 μg hgp100 or 100 μg Ova, 50 or 25 μg anti-CD40 antibody, and 25 μg Poly-IC). Enhanced the anti- tumor activity of TriVax. |
